    Daily Mirror – Baby Arthur first in UK to have £1.8m drug on the NHS

    The Daily Mirror’s front page leads with the story of baby Arthur Morgan who has a spinal disorder and became the first UK patient to have had a £1.8m drug on the NHS.  

    Daily Mirror logo


    Face of hope: Baby Arthur Morgan first in UK to get £1.8m drug on NHS

    The Daily Mirror reports that baby Arthur Morgan, a five-month-old who has a spinal disorder, has had a £1.8m drug on the NHS to give him a chance of life.

    Bank Holiday heatwave: Day we all stepped out into the sun

    Sharing the front page is an image of Bank Holiday revellers enjoying Britain’s hottest day of the year so far, after a wet and miserable May, expert say the sunshine will continue breaking records this week. 


    Headlines from the Mirror Online. 

    Travellers ‘refusing to move’ from plush suburb where homes sell for £2million

    The Mirror says travellers are said to be ignoring a council’s pleas to move from a park located in a plush London suburb – where homes sell for £2million.

    The group set up on Kew Green on Thursday and have reportedly rejected officials who asked them to move on.

    School days ‘to be made longer in bid to catch up on schooling post-Covid’

    The Mirror says school kids could be made to stay behind an extra half and hour to catch up with classes missed due to Covid, it has been reported.

    The government is reportedly set to demand that pupils must be kept at school for another two and a half hours each week.

    Bafta scraps special awards after Noel Clarke scandal amid more shamed celeb fears

    The Mirror says the Bafta TV Awards will not honour any stars with a Fellowship or Special Award for the first time in its 50-year history, in the wake of the Noel Clarke scandal.

    Bosses have suspended all the individual honours which are “in the gift of the Academy” – rather than voted for by an industry panel – for Sunday’s ceremony.

    Billionaire Tory donor’s daughter-in-law charged after police chief shot dead

    The Mirror says a British billionaire’s daughter-in-law has been charged with manslaughter after a cop was shot dead, it has been reported.

    The body of superintendent Henry Jemmott, 42, was found floating in the sea near a pier in San Pedro, Belize on Friday.
